What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Spravato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Spravato Manager, you need a solid background in healthcare administration, clinical protocols, and knowledge of psychiatric treatments, often supported by a relevant degree and experience in behavioral health settings. Familiarity with Spravato (esketamine) Risk Evaluation and Mitigation Strategy (REMS) programs, electronic medical records (EMRs), and compliance documentation is essential.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ication with patients and multidisciplinary teams are crucial soft skills. These competencies ensure safe, effective delivery of Spravato therapy, regulatory compliance, and high-quality patient care.

What are some common challenges Spravato Managers face when coordinating patient care and treatment schedules?

Spravato Managers often encounter challenges balancing the coordination of patient appointments with the strict monitoring requirements mandated by REMS (Risk Evaluation and Mitigation Strategy) programs. Ensuring patients adhere to dosing schedules, managing potential side effects, and maintaining clear communication among physicians, pharmacists, and patients are key aspects of the role. Additionally, navigating insurance authorizations and supporting patients through the approval process can be time-consuming. Effective organization and strong interpersonal skills are essential to successfully manage these responsibilities and provide optimal patient care.

What are Spravato Managers and what do they do?

Spravato Managers are healthcare professionals responsible for overseeing the administration and management of Spravato (esketamine) treatment programs. They coordinate patient care, ensure compliance with safety protocols, and manage logistics such as scheduling and documentation. Spravato Managers often serve as the main point of contact between patients, prescribers, and insurance companies, ensuring that each treatment session is conducted safely and efficiently. Their role is critical in supporting patients with treatment-resistant depression and streamlining the process for both staff and patients.

About Lakeview Center
Lakeview Center provides comprehensive behavioral health care to adults and children with mental illnesses, drug and alcohol dependencies and intellectual disabilities. Across Northwest Florida, our services range from residential treatment to outpatient counseling, psychiatry, trauma care, treatments for substance misuse and 24/7 support for those with serious mental illnesses.
